Due to their versatility, immunochemistry analyzers are relied upon for diagnosis and monitoring of a range of different conditions including diabetes, infectious disease testing, cancer diagnostics, and cardiac market tests. The immunochemistry analyzer market is large due to its involvement in a broad range of indications and is also being driven by rises in the prevalence of numerous diseases, as well as aging populations. Due to increased demand for lab automation and their continued use for routine diagnostic and patient monitoring purposes, immunochemistry analyzers are expected to increase in market value and will continue to be a primary method for laboratory diagnostic testing, measuring parameters linked to a wide range of diseases such as thyroid disorders, women's health, diabetes, infectious diseases; cardiac markers; and cancer.
Immunochemistry Analyzers model includes Chemiluminescence (CLIA), Immunofluorescence, Enzyme Immuno Assays (EIAs) and Point-Of-Care (POC) Analyzers as sub-segments.
